The Sydney Outlet Village insertions operate as a spatial transition between two distinct retail conditions: the enclosed Stage 1 mall and the open-air town centre of Stage 2. The junction remains a primary circulation path, but is resolved as a defined threshold. Movement is compressed and redirected through a controlled sequence of arched forms, establishing rhythm, orientation, and a clear shift in spatial condition. Lighting is embedded within the structure, reinforcing the geometry while allowing the space to adjust in tone when required. The insertion operates as a permanent architectural framework that can accommodate temporary retail activations without altering the underlying design. The result is a controlled transition, a shift from internal to external, from enclosed to open.
